What Exactly is Lead Qualification?
In the simplest terms, lead qualification is the process of figuring out if a prospect is worth your time. For a nonprofit, a "qualified" lead is someone who has both the capacity to give (wealth) and the inclination to give (affinity for your cause).
Think of it like dating. You wouldn't want to spend six months trying to convince someone to like sushi if they’re allergic to fish. Lead qualification helps you find the sushi lovers first so you can skip the awkward dinners and get straight to the "happily ever after" (or in our case, the impact-driven partnership).

Step 1: The Survey – Your Secret Weapon
Before the AI magic starts, you need a way to hear from your audience. One of the most effective ways to start the qualification process is a simple, well-crafted survey.
Why a survey? Because it gives your donors a voice. It’s the first touchpoint where they can tell you what they care about. But here’s the trick: don’t just ask for money. Ask about their why.
- What motivated you to join our mailing list?
- Which of our programs do you feel most passionate about?
- Have you ever considered including a charity in your will? (A classic planned giving qualifier!)
A survey acts as a filter. People who take the time to fill it out are already showing a higher level of engagement than someone who just scrolls past your emails.

Wealth Data: The "Could They?"
AI can instantly cross-reference your survey respondents with public wealth indicators. We’re talking about real estate holdings, stock ownership, and previous political or charitable giving.

Sentiment Analysis: The "Would They?"
This is the truly "smart" part of AI. Modern tools can perform sentiment analysis. By looking at the language used in survey comments or even the tone of voice in virtual agent call campaigns, AI can detect how a person actually feels about your organization.
- Are they using words of excitement and urgency?
- Are they asking specific questions about your impact?
- Is their tone lukewarm or "just checking in"?
AI can flag "High Sentiment" leads who might not have the highest wealth score but are incredibly loyal. These are your future monthly donors, volunteers, and advocates.
Step 3: Prioritizing Your "Maybes"
Now that the AI has crunched the numbers, it gives you a prioritized list. Instead of a messy spreadsheet, you have a roadmap.
Imagine your leads are grouped into four buckets:
- The Superstars: High Wealth + High Sentiment. (Call these people immediately!)
- The Quiet Giants: High Wealth + Low Sentiment. (These folks need more education and engagement before you ask for a gift.)
- The Loyal Hearts: Low Wealth + High Sentiment. (Your perfect candidates for monthly giving or volunteer leadership.)
- The Long Shots: Low Wealth + Low Sentiment. (Keep them on the newsletter, but don’t spend your precious manual labor hours here.)
